In our research work, the effective aspects of the experience of foreign countries in developing scientific research competence in students are analyzed and their compatibility with practice in our country is revealed. Also, the essence of content analysis and comparative pedagogical analysis as a methodology are studied. As a scientific innovation, methods are proposed that connect free time resources with scientific research competence.
